Dimensions of a 45ft Container

The 45ft cargo containers container, also called the 45-foot high cube container, is a basic size used in global shipping. Here are the crucial dimensions:

  • External Length: 45 feet (13.72 meters)
  • External Width: 8 feet (2.44 meters)
  • External Height: 9 feet 6 inches (2.90 meters)
  • Internal Length: 43 feet 10 inches (13.36 meters)
  • Internal Width: 7 feet 8 inches (2.34 meters)
  • Internal Height: 8 feet 6 inches (2.59 meters)
  • Door Opening: 7 feet 8 inches (2.34 meters) broad and 8 feet 6 inches (2.59 meters) high

Key Features of a 45ft Container

  1. Increased Capacity:

    • The 45ft container provides more internal volume compared to its 40ft equivalent. This makes it perfect for carrying bigger amounts of items, lowering the requirement for multiple smaller containers and potentially reducing shipping costs.
  2. High Cube Design:

    • The "high cube" classification suggests that the container is taller than basic containers, offering an additional 1 foot (0.30 meters) in height. This extra area is especially helpful for shipping high or bulky items.
  3. Weight Capacity:

    • The optimum gross weight for a 45ft container is typically around 67,200 pounds (30,480 kgs), with a tare weight (empty weight) of roughly 11,000 pounds (4,990 kilograms). The payload capacity, therefore, is around 56,200 pounds (25,490 kilograms).
  4. Resilience and Security:

    • Constructed from premium products, 45ft containers are developed to stand up to the rigors of long-distance shipping. They are geared up with robust door locks and seals to make sure the safety and security of the cargo.
  5. Flexibility:

    • These containers can be utilized for a large range of goods, from consumer items and machinery to food and pharmaceuticals. They are also appropriate for intermodal transportation, indicating they can be easily moved in between ships, trains, and trucks.

Applications in the Shipping Industry

  1. Bulk Goods:

    • The 45ft container is particularly helpful for shipping bulk items such as furnishings, devices, and electronics. Its increased capacity allows for more effective use of area, minimizing the number of shipments required.
  2. Job Cargo:

    • For massive tasks, such as building or industrial equipment, the 45ft container supplies the necessary space to transport extra-large or heavy items.
  3. Retail and Consumer Goods:

    • Retailers and e-commerce business often utilize 45ft containers to ship a range of products, from clothes and shoes to home goods and electronics. The bigger capacity assists in managing stock and decreasing shipping expenses.
  4. Food and Beverage:

    • The food and drink market gain from the 45ft container's capability to preserve consistent temperatures and supply adequate space for disposable goods. Refrigerated variations of these containers, known as reefer containers, are frequently utilized for this function.
